Series synopsis
Stop! Border Control, also known as ¡ALTO! Frontera is an American documentary television series that premiered on A&E on September 27, 2020. It was created by Julián Becker. It stars Julio Bracho.
From bustling airports to remote crossings, this series uncovers the high-risk world of border security at Arturo Merino Benítez International Airport, also known as Santiago International Airport and Nuevo Pudahuel Airport, where every bag, every traveler, and every decision could change everything.

Episodes
This series spans 3 seasons with 42 episodes.
| Season | Episodes | First aired | Last aired |
|---|---|---|---|
| Season 1 | 18 | September 27, 2020 | January 24, 2021 |
| Season 2 | 12 | February 9, 2022 | April 27, 2022 |
| Season 3 | 12 | June 13, 2025 | June 13, 2025 |
